From 89bf4ac2337539f224a2035507427509ff398f82 Mon Sep 17 00:00:00 2001 From: xyiege Date: Sun, 17 Jul 2022 14:57:40 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9B=B4=E6=96=B0=E4=BB=A3=E7=A0=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/cn/chjyj/szwh/mapper/OrderUserMapper.java | 2 +- .../szwh/service/impl/AccountCloseServiceImpl.java | 12 ++++++++++-- src/main/resources/mapper/szwh/OrderUserMapper.xml | 2 +- .../cn/chjyj/szwh/mapper/OrderUserMapperTest.java | 6 ++++++ 4 files changed, 18 insertions(+), 4 deletions(-) diff --git a/src/main/java/cn/chjyj/szwh/mapper/OrderUserMapper.java b/src/main/java/cn/chjyj/szwh/mapper/OrderUserMapper.java index ea8203a..e48ec56 100644 --- a/src/main/java/cn/chjyj/szwh/mapper/OrderUserMapper.java +++ b/src/main/java/cn/chjyj/szwh/mapper/OrderUserMapper.java @@ -33,5 +33,5 @@ public interface OrderUserMapper { * 订单结算 * @return */ - Map ordercs(); + List ordercs(); } diff --git a/src/main/java/cn/chjyj/szwh/service/impl/AccountCloseServiceImpl.java b/src/main/java/cn/chjyj/szwh/service/impl/AccountCloseServiceImpl.java index 6cb317a..3e9c4cc 100644 --- a/src/main/java/cn/chjyj/szwh/service/impl/AccountCloseServiceImpl.java +++ b/src/main/java/cn/chjyj/szwh/service/impl/AccountCloseServiceImpl.java @@ -66,9 +66,17 @@ public class AccountCloseServiceImpl implements AccountCloseService { */ @Override public Map closeList(Map qmap, int limit, int page) { + Map retmap =new HashMap(); + int start = page>1?(page-1)*limit:0; + + retmap.put("start",start); + retmap.put("end",page*limit); + retmap.put("page",page); + retmap.put("per_page",limit); // 按照用户isli 分组 //List idlist=orderUserMapper.isligroup(); - Map xmap = orderUserMapper.ordercs(); - return xmap; + List xlist = orderUserMapper.ordercs(); + retmap.put("data",xlist); + return retmap; } } diff --git a/src/main/resources/mapper/szwh/OrderUserMapper.xml b/src/main/resources/mapper/szwh/OrderUserMapper.xml index 976f8bf..7b7710c 100644 --- a/src/main/resources/mapper/szwh/OrderUserMapper.xml +++ b/src/main/resources/mapper/szwh/OrderUserMapper.xml @@ -28,7 +28,7 @@ - SELECT u.islicode as islicode,u.`name`,u.publicAccount, u.bankName,u.userType,o.close_status FROM order_user u INNER JOIN `order` o ON u.batchcode=o.batchcode diff --git a/src/test/java/cn/chjyj/szwh/mapper/OrderUserMapperTest.java b/src/test/java/cn/chjyj/szwh/mapper/OrderUserMapperTest.java index 865bbfe..318916d 100644 --- a/src/test/java/cn/chjyj/szwh/mapper/OrderUserMapperTest.java +++ b/src/test/java/cn/chjyj/szwh/mapper/OrderUserMapperTest.java @@ -34,4 +34,10 @@ public class OrderUserMapperTest { } //System.out.println(mp.size()); } + + @Test + public void ordcs(){ + List xxlist = orderUserMapper.ordercs(); + System.out.println(xxlist.size()); + } } \ No newline at end of file